**Action Item 7 — Read-replica lag alarm tuning**

Owner: data platform rotation. The Quillbrook replica lag alarm fired 14 times during the incident, all noise, because the threshold was set for the old single-replica topology. Raise the warning threshold to 30s, page only at 120s sustained over three evaluation windows, and exclude the analytics replica entirely. Verify against the last 90 days of lag metrics before merging. Done criteria: zero false pages for two weeks. Tuning rationale and threshold math are recorded here:

wiki page, bagaf-fawip: https://harbor.tolvaqsys.local/pages/repo/pages/secrets/eac969ffc71f356b

Hollet (chair), M. Draycott, T. Vass, L. Imbry. The committee reviewed the proposal to raise rates for legacy Cindermark subscribers by 9% from the next renewal cycle. Draycott presented churn modelling indicating acceptable attrition under 4%. Vass raised concerns about contracts signed before the Ashgate migration; legal review is underway. Communications to affected customers will be staged over six weeks, with retention offers available at manager discretion. The confidential note below states the strategic basis for this decision.

board note of kagep-yahig: Only 9 of the 120 pilot accounts renewed Quenix, so a churn review is set for April 1.

UserSplit Cutover Drift: the extracted account service and the legacy Marigold monolith user module are reporting divergent record counts during dual-write. This fires when drift exceeds 0.5% over 15 minutes. New team members should not replay writes manually. Reconciliation steps and the rollback procedure are documented on the internal page.

wiki page, tajog-fafog: https://gitlab.paliqsys.corp/dash/display/job/853dd6fcbf54